Sunshine Committee seeks five-year extension to finish review of public-record exemptions
Summary
Co-chairs of the Oregon Sunshine Committee told the Senate Judiciary Committee the group needs five more years to complete a review of public-record exemptions; the bill would also change the committee report recipient and de-establish a subcommittee that rarely meets
Senate Bill 890 would extend the Oregon Sunshine Committee's statutory existence by five years so it can complete a review of exemptions to public records law, the committee heard Feb. 10.
